Skip to content

估计运动目标的速度

来源: https://vis-webcontent.s3.amazonaws.com/quickguides/SAR+Essentials/Estimate+Velocity+Moving+Targets/index.html#/

第 1 课 / 共 1 课

估计运动目标的速度

在本快速指南中,您将:

  • • 了解估计运动目标速度所需满足的条件。
  • • 使用 SAR 速度估计 工具来确定海上移动船只的速度。

示例数据

本快速指南中的练习使用一张 Sentinel-1 功率图像进行演示。

[SAREssentials_VelocityEstimation.zip

8.6 MB

下载Arrow down with horizontal line beneath it](assets/SAREssentials_VelocityEstimation.zip)

  • 文件名: Sentinel1_Skagen_pwr。同时包含一个 ENVI 头文件 (.hdr) 和一个 ENVI SARscape 元数据文件 (.sml)。
  • 获取日期: 2019年7月16日
  • 处理说明: 这是从 Sentinel-1 干涉宽幅(IW)单视复型(SLC)数据集衍生出的空间子集、多视处理的功率图像。我们使用 SAR Essentials 中的 基础数据处理 工具创建了此功率图像。
  • 来源: 欧盟,哥白尼哨兵一号(Sentinel-1)影像。源 ID 为 S1A_IW_SLC__1SDV_20190716T053200_20190716T053227_028138_032D98_EDA1.SAFE。

背景知识

要理解速度估计的工作原理,您应该了解一些基本原理。朝距离向移动的物体通常会在图像中相对于其真实位置发生偏移。距离向 垂直于卫星的飞行轨迹,飞行轨迹也称为 方位向

例如,请看下面彩色子孔径图像中移动的火车。我们知道它在运动是因为其彩虹般的颜色。(更多信息请参见 SAR Essentials: 检测运动目标 快速指南。)铁轨显示为暗红色线条。当火车沿着与卫星方位向相同的方向行驶时,白色条纹接近火车在轨道上的真实位置。然而,当火车偏离并更多地转向距离向行驶时,图像显示火车与轨道之间存在很大的偏移。

您可以利用这种位置偏移来估计火车的速度。因此,速度估计需要满足以下条件:

  • • 物体必须具有显著的 距离向分量,这意味着它正在沿距离向(垂直于卫星飞行轨迹)移动,并且存在明显的位置偏移。
  • • 图像中应包含能指示物体真实位置的视觉线索。这可能包括移动车辆的道路、火车的铁轨或船只留下的尾流。

如果您尝试估计一个沿方位向(平行于卫星飞行轨迹)移动的物体的速度,您将收到一条错误消息,表明其速度无法确定。

让我们看一个使用海上移动船只的示例。

运行 SAR 速度估计工具

  • 1 启动 ENVI。
  • 2 在 工具箱 中,进入 SAR Essentials 文件夹并展开 Moving Target 文件夹。
  • 3 双击 SAR Velocity EstimationSAR Velocity Estimation Tool 对话框出现。

  • 4 点击 SAR Velocity Estimation Tool 菜单栏中的 Open 菜单选项,然后选择 Open ImageSAR Select Image 对话框出现。
  • 5 点击 Input Image 旁边的 Browse 按钮。出现文件选择对话框。
  • 6 转到您保存本快速指南示例数据的位置。
  • 7 选择文件 Sentinel1_Skagen_pwr.sml 并点击 Open
  • 8 在 SAR Select Image 对话框中点击 OK。几秒钟后,图像被添加到 图层管理器 并显示在 图像窗口 中。以下截图显示了完整范围的图像。

明亮的物体是移动的船只。它们与其尾流(即真实位置)略有偏移,尾流显示为直线。此处,方位向为垂直方向,距离向为水平方向。

  • 9 (可选):点击 Units 菜单选项并选择 Knots(节)。
  • 10 缩放到单艘船只,然后点击 Start 按钮。光标变为十字准线符号。
  • 11 点击尾流的一端,然后再次点击另一端。两点之间绘制出一条虚线。光标变为一个黄色圆圈。
  • 12 点击船只的中心。

速度和方向箭头显示在船只旁边:

  • 13 点击 Start 按钮,然后点击 Stop 按钮。这将重置绘图模式。
  • 14 对下图中显示的船只重复相同的步骤。您的估计值可能与此处显示的略有不同:

  • 15 缩放到下方红色图像放大镜中显示的船只:

请注意,尾流位于船只的左侧,并且沿方位向垂直延伸。这与图像中的其他尾流不同。

  • 16 点击 Start 按钮。
  • 17 点击垂直尾流的一端,然后再次点击另一端。两点之间绘制出一条虚线。
  • 18 点击船只的中心。几秒钟后,出现一条错误消息:

该消息表明无法确定速度,因为您沿着尾流绘制的线与方位向平行。重申一下,如果您想计算物体的速度,它们必须沿着距离向移动。

  • 19 点击 OK 关闭错误消息。
  • 20 点击 Stop 按钮。
  • 21 (可选):要擦除先前绘制的标注,请点击 Annotations 菜单选项,并选择 Remove Latest(移除单个项目)或 Remove All(移除所有项目)。
  • 22 在 图层管理器 中,展开 SAR Measurements 项目以查看各个标注项目。每个标注集由三个项目组成:(1) 速度估计值,(2) "Direction"(方向)箭头,以及 (3) "Displacement"(位移)线,显示物体与其真实位置之间的位移方向;例如:

  • 23 要为将来的 ENVI 会话保存标注,请在 图层管理器 中右键单击 SAR Measurements 项目并选择 Save As。然后指定一个带有 .anz 扩展名的输出文件名。

本快速指南到此结束。

其他资源

  • SAR Essentials: 在彩色子孔径图像中检测运动目标 快速指南
  • SAR Essentials: 在动态孔径图像中检测运动目标 快速指南
  • SAR Essentials: 使用逆合成孔径雷达重聚焦运动物体 快速指南

您的意见对我们很重要,请花几分钟时间填写我们的快速指南反馈表(opens in a new tab)

© 2025 NV5 Geospatial Solutions, Inc. 此信息不受《国际武器贸易条例》(ITAR) 或《出口管理条例》(EAR) 的管制。